用虛擬機沙盒架設比特幣錢包環境
簡述
既然已經入坑區塊鏈,不屯點數字貨幣有點說不過去,比特幣是我的首選,漲跌不重要,權當是給信仰充值吧。進行幣的交易,最重要的當然是資產安全,比較好的方式是自己的幣絕不要長期放在交易所錢包內,儘快轉入自己的錢包。而自己的錢包由兩台電腦組成:一台不上網,錢包冷存儲,另一台進行聯網操作,兩者之間用U盤傳輸必要的數據和信息。這兩台計算機都不要使用Windows,macOS這類大路貨操作系統,以免被常見的病毒木馬入侵。顯然,這個門檻有點太高了,包爸就介紹一種自己摸索出來的方法:在平時使用的單台計算機上,通過架設兩個虛擬機,分別安裝冷熱錢包軟體,以這種沙盒化的方式,來實現相對安全一些的比特幣錢包環境。
適用人群
以下內容適用於對計算機有一定認識(起碼知道虛擬機是怎麼回事)、對比特幣錢包也有概念的人。這套方法會額外佔用十幾G的硬碟空間,安裝冷錢包的虛擬機最好使用U盤額外備份一份。
操作步驟
1. 用虛擬機1安裝錢包冷存儲環境
1. [下載]( https://www.ubuntu.com.cn/download/alternative-downloads )Ubuntu 16.04 64位版本的安裝盤映像文件
2. [下載]( https://my.vmware.com/cn/web/vmware/free#desktop_end_user_computing/vmware_workstation_player/14_0 )安裝vmware workstation player軟體(以下簡稱vm player)
3. 創建Ubuntu16.04 64位操作系統的虛擬機
1. 運行vm player,選擇創建新虛擬機,安裝來源選擇「安裝程序光碟映像文件」,然後選擇第一步下載的安裝盤映像文件
2. 最大磁碟大小選20G應夠用了,選擇「將虛擬磁碟拆分成多個文件」(安裝後占磁碟空間大約6G)
3. 安裝過程中應選擇本地時區及中文支持,將這台虛擬機命名為「冷血」:)root用戶名和密碼絕不能和宿主計算機操作系統的用戶名、密碼一致或近似
4. 安裝完畢後進行系統設置,屏幕解析度什麼的可以調成最低的,進入Ubuntu Software Center,卸載辦公等不需要的軟體
5. 使用Firefox瀏覽器訪問Armory[網站]( https://btcarmory.com/0.96.3-release/ ) ,下載安裝包
6. 更新Ubuntu系統,打開Terminal,輸入命令
sudo apt-get update
7. 重啟後關機,進入player軟體該虛擬機設置,將網路適配器內的「啟動時連接」選項取消勾選
4. 安裝Armory錢包離線版
「冷血」虛擬機再次開機,雙擊Armory安裝包文件安裝
5. 生成新錢包並生成紙備份
1. 啟動Armory(Offline),依次填寫name, description, passphrase,生成錢包
2. 按Armory提示,備份錢包,生成列印備份(列印為PDF文件並保存到U盤),PDF文件列印後刪除,passphrase可以寫在列印文件背面,然後把這張紙妥善保存
6. 備份「冷血」虛擬機
上述過程完成後,可以將「冷血」虛擬機關機,然後到vm player中查看此虛擬機的硬碟文件所在路徑,將這些文件備份到不常用的U盤或其他介質中。以後如果生成了新錢包,或轉出比特幣時做簽名操作後,需要再次備份
2. 用虛擬機2安裝熱錢包環境
1. 創建ubuntu16.04 64位操作系統的虛擬機(同上,但是不要將網路適配器關閉),這台虛擬機可以命名為「熱血」
2. 安裝Bither輕錢包
「熱血」虛擬機開機,到[網站]( https://bither.net/ )下載Bither安裝包文件,安裝
3. 導入Armory建立的錢包
1. 運行Bither輕錢包軟體
2. 點擊Import,然後選擇From Private Key Text,輸入從「冷血」中拷貝/保存的key,然後建立新密碼
3. 導入成功後可以看到錢包餘額與交易等
4. 界面中間上方,有三行字元組成的是錢包地址,點擊右側的"Copy"按鈕,將地址複製下來
3. 買入比特幣
1. 在交易所網站註冊賬戶,買比特幣到交易所配給你的錢包
2. 在交易所網站點擊發送比特幣,在「接收比特幣地址」中填入剛剛複製的自己的錢包地址,然後輸入比特幣數量和手續費後發送
3. 打開「熱血」虛擬機,運行Bither輕錢包,等待剛才發送的比特幣交易確認後,出現在錢包中
4. 手機app
* 單純看行情可以在google play市場搜索CryptoCurrency應用,可以在桌面上放置即時行情的widget
* 手機錢包可以安裝Bither(Android和iOS的都有)
5. 賣出比特幣
尚未嘗試
參考資料
* [Armory比特幣錢包PC端]( https://maimaicoins.com/bitcoin-armory-wallet-desktop/ )
* [比特幣及錢包的基礎知識]( https://yunbi.zendesk.com/hc/zh-cn/articles/115004887367-%E6%AF%94%E7%89%B9%E5%B8%81%E5%8F%8A%E9%92%B1%E5%8C%85%E7%9A%84%E5%9F%BA%E7%A1%80%E7%9F%A5%E8%AF%86 )
* [關於比特幣的「冷存儲」和Armory的使用]( http://8btc.com/thread-1164-1-1.html )
TAG:140041 |